🎶 Unleash Your Sound with Wireless Freedom!
The LEKATO 5.8Ghz Wireless Guitar System offers a plug-and-play solution for musicians seeking high-quality audio transmission without the hassle of cables. With UHF technology, it supports up to 4 channels, ensuring seamless connectivity and a dynamic range of 110dB. The system features a rechargeable battery for extended playtime and a rotatable plug design for compatibility with various electric instruments.

Great Product, Well made
Love these units. This my second set. They are made of sturdy plastic and a strong hinge to allow folding of the 1/4 inch connector, The tone for acoustic guitars is true and the range is as stated in the description. These units are designed well with a pad on the back to protect your guitar. They also work to send the guitar signal from a pedal board to amp or mixer allowing for decreased wire management issue. They fit nicely into my transport case and sound great. They allow for multiple channels so more than one set can be used at once.

These work great!
I used them in a live stage situation and also practicing at home. They work great. I don't know what the range might be but up to 30 feet was no problem at all. If you un-mate them by playing around with them while waiting to go on stage, the fix is quick and easy, but you will probably need to have the directions handy.Word to the wise: it happened to me and I went into a panic when they no longer worked while I was standing on stage and preparing to use them. In my need to be ready right now, I just grabbed a cord and played wired for that set.Afterwards, I read the directions and re-mated them in about 2 minutes. And they have not un-mated again because I no longer "play" with them while waiting to go on stage.
